// Client setup for the Quillhook queue-depth autoscaler.
// Polls depth on the ingest queues every 15s; scales workers 2–40.
// Support: if scaling stalls, check poller heartbeat first, then
// requeue lag. Do not change thresholds without a change ticket.
// The client authenticates against the scaler API with the key below.

gateway credential: kto23_LX9A4ys6i4nzHtpOLNLodKK

Vendor note: the weather-alert fan-out for the Stormline service is handled by our vendor, Cloudmere Systems, under the Tier 2 delivery contract. If fan-out latency exceeds five minutes or alerts arrive out of order, capture the batch identifiers from the dispatch log before escalating, as Cloudmere requires them for triage. Their duty desk operates around the clock. Escalations should be sent to the address below.

pager mailbox: praix@zarqelstack.internal

# Service Accounts — SpokeShift Rebalancer

Support: use the svc-rebalance account only. It reads dock fill levels from the Hubline feed and writes van assignments. Do not use personal logins for this. Token lifetime is 90 days; ops rotates it. If a customer reports stale dock counts, verify the account first. For manual checks, authenticate against Hubline with the key below.

app token of bahaf-tajeg = zpat23_SjjsllwiLmXbtS65veZaV47